A crown hair transplant in Philadelphia is a specialized procedure designed to restore hair to the top and back of the head, where hair loss is often most noticeable. The cost of this procedure can vary significantly based on several factors, including the extent of hair loss, the number of grafts required, the technique used (FUE or FUT), and the expertise of the surgeon.
On average, a crown hair transplant in Philadelphia can range from $4,000 to $15,000. This wide price range reflects the complexity of the procedure and the individual needs of each patient. For instance, those with extensive hair loss may require more grafts, which can increase the overall cost. Additionally, the choice between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E) and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T) can also impact the price. FUE, which involves extracting individual hair follicles, is generally more expensive but results in less noticeable scarring.

Factors Influencing the Cost
Several elements contribute to the variability in the cost of a crown hair transplant. These include:
Surgeon's Experience and Reputation: Highly skilled and reputable surgeons typically command higher fees. Their extensive experience ensures better results, reducing the risk of complications and achieving a more natural hairline.
Technique Used: The method of hair transplantation can impact the cost. Advanced techniques like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E) and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T) are more precise but may be pricier due to the complexity and time involved.
Facility and Equipment: The quality and state-of-the-art nature of the facility and equipment used can also affect the cost. Modern, well-equipped clinics often provide better care and results.
Geographical Location: The cost can vary depending on the city and region. Philadelphia, being a major metropolitan area, may have higher costs compared to smaller cities.
